青壮年Pauwels III型股骨颈骨折内固定治疗的选择策略
Selection Strategies for Internal Fixation of Pauwels Type III Femoral Neck Fractures in Young Adults

Abstract:

青壮年Pauwels III型股骨颈骨折的治疗在骨科仍具有一定挑战,骨折多由高能量损伤引起,移位明显、创伤大,术后股骨头坏死的发生率仍很高。内固定植入物在不断地创新与改进,然而世界范围内仍无公认的“金标准”,选择何种内固定植入物对减轻患者经济和疼痛是临床亟需解决的问题。本文对青壮年股骨颈骨折的分型、手术入路和内固定方法的选择等做一综述,旨在为临床治疗此类骨折提供一些建议。
The treatment of Pauwels type III femoral neck fractures in young adults is still a challenge in or-thopedics. The fractures are mostly caused by high-energy injuries, with obvious displacement and large trauma. The incidence of postoperative femoral head necrosis is still high. Internal fixation implants are constantly innovating and improving, but there is still no recognized “gold standard” worldwide. It is an urgent clinical problem to choose which internal fixation implant can relieve the patient’s economy and pain. This article reviews the classification of femoral neck fractures in young and middle-aged adults, the selection of surgical approaches and internal fixation methods, and aims to provide some suggestions for the clinical treatment of such fractures.
